NTZ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review
15 of the 4,012 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Natuzzi (NTZ)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$20.5M — down 25% from $27.2M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in NTZ was balanced in Q3 2017: 2 funds opened new positions, 2 closed out, 3 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.
The largest buyer was William Blair & Company, opening a new position worth an estimated $64.1K. The largest seller was Aegis Financial, cutting an estimated $510K.
